Roger Clemens Issues Another Mea Culpa…

In an effort to save not only face, but his reputation, Roger Clemens once again denied ever using steroids.

From the Baltimore Sun: Roger Clemens posted a video today repeating his denials of the steroids use alleged against him in the Mitchell Report. He also said he would be interviewed for a future episode of "60 Minutes," but a spokesman for CBS said nothing has been finalized.

The seven-time Cy Young Award winner was accused in the report of using steroids, an allegation made by his former trainer.

In October last year, the Los Angeles Times reported Clemens was linked to steroids in the May 2006 sworn statement of a federal agent who cited former big league pitcher Jason Grimsley. At the time, the names of players in the public version had been blacked out. When the full affidavit was unsealed Thursday, Clemens' name was not in it, and the paper issued a correction and an apology.

"I faced this last year when the L.A. Times reported that I used steroids. I said it was not true then, and now the whole world knows it's not true, now that that's come out," Clemens said in the video, which was posted Sunday on the Web site of his foundation and on You Tube.
